Quaker Student Scholarships

Westtown School prioritizes students applying for financial aid who are or whose parents are members of a Quaker Meeting. In addition, there are two specific funds dedicated to Quaker students detailed below. To be considered for any of these, be sure to indicate on the SAO Westtown Supplemental form if the applicant or parent is a Member of the Society of Friends and enter the name of the Meeting.

Sally Barton Scholarship for Boarding Students

These grants are available to all Quaker students, new or currently enrolled, who meet all of the following qualifications:

  • The student (or their parent) is a member of a Monthly meeting of the Religious Society of Friends.
  • The student will have participated in the life of Meeting for more than one year.
  • The student will have demonstrated a commitment to community and to personal, intellectual and spiritual growth.
  • Students must participate in the Quaker Leadership Program for a minimum of two years.
  • The student’s family must demonstrate need through the financial aid application.

National Friends Education Fund (NFEF) Tuition Aid Program

The National Friends Education Fund (NFEF), administered by Friends Council on Education, provides financial assistance for each K-12th grade child whose family are members of Philadelphia Yearly Meeting (PYM) and who demonstrates financial need.
For more information, visit the Friends Council Education website. Quaker families may complete an application, forward it to their Monthly Meeting for a clerk’s signature, and return the application to the Westtown School Admission Office by no later than February 15th.
